Susan Aglukark is a renowned Canadian Inuit singer-songwriter and advocate for Indigenous rights, known for her efforts to raise awareness about the challenges faced by Indigenous communities. Through her music, she blends traditional Inuit sounds with contemporary genres, promoting cultural pride and understanding. Aglukark has also been involved in various initiatives aimed at mental health, education, and youth empowerment, using her platform to inspire change and foster dialogue on Indigenous issues globally. Her contributions extend beyond music, as she actively engages in advocacy and community development efforts.
